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up cooked quinoa
  • 1 medium butternut squash (peeled and cubed)
  • 2 cups kale
  • 1 medium apple
  • 1/2 cup dried cranberries
  • 1/4 cup pumpkin seeds (optional)
  • 1/4 cup tahini
  • 2 tablespoons maple syrup
  • 2 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 24 tablespoons warm water
  • to taste salt
  • to taste pepper

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. On a baking sheet, spread cubed butternut squash, drizzle with olive oil, and season with salt and pepper. Roast for about 25 minutes until tender.
  3. Rinse quinoa under cold water and cook according to package instructions (generally, use 2 cups of water per cup of quinoa).
  4. In a mixing bowl, combine tahini, maple syrup, apple cider vinegar, olive oil, salt, pepper, and warm water; whisk until smooth.
  5. Assemble bowls by layering quinoa at the base and topping with roasted squash, kale, diced apple, cranberries, and pumpkin seeds.
  6. Drizzle dressing over each bowl before serving.
